US Post Office in Nampa, Idaho is located at 407 12th Avenue Rd. The US Post Office Number is (208) 467-3991.
407 12th Avenue Rd, Nampa, ID
US Post Office in Nampa, Idaho is located at 407 12th Avenue Rd. The US Post Office Number is (208) 467-3991.
Wind
Wind Direction